Why chalk dust is a unique skincare problem for climbing instructors

Most skincare advice for athletes assumes outdoor sun, sweat, or chlorine. Indoor climbing instructors face a stranger combination. Loose chalk and liquid chalk both deposit basic magnesium carbonate on the skin, raising surface pH from its healthy 4.7-5.5 range into the 8-9 zone. That alkaline shift slows ceramide synthesis, weakens the lipid mortar between corneocytes, and gives transient irritants — sweat salts, rubber off-gassing from shoes, holds-cleaner residue — an open lane into the barrier. Add a gym HVAC running at 30-40% relative humidity and you have a recipe for tight, flaking cheeks, perioral redness, and the subtle crepe texture instructors often notice at the temple and jawline by Thursday.

What to skip when chalk dust is in the picture

Three categories of product tend to make things worse for instructors. First, exfoliating acids more than twice a week — chalk has already raised pH and lifted the top corneocytes, so layering on AHAs or BHAs simply opens the door wider. Second, drying clay masks marketed for 'oily skin' — instructors are often misclassified as oily because of mid-shift T-zone sweat, but the underlying skin is dehydrated, not oil-overproducing. Third, scented essences or alcohol-heavy toners, which sting on the micro-fissures chalk creates around the nostrils and mouth. How chalk type changes the routine

Loose magnesium-carbonate chalk creates the worst ambient dust load and the most facial deposition; instructors who teach kids' classes in chalk-permissive gyms get the heaviest exposure. Liquid chalk — ethanol-based — is gentler on the air but adds a defatting agent to any hand-to-face contact, so it tends to dry the cheeks and chin even more aggressively in concentrated bursts. Block chalk falls between the two. Regardless of type, the strategy is the same: ceramide pre-load, hydrate with Aiming Lotion R, soothe mid-shift, seal post-shift. Does chalk actually penetrate the skin or just sit on top?

Magnesium carbonate does not penetrate intact skin, but it raises surface pH and physically adheres to sebum, which means it stays in contact long enough to disrupt the acid mantle and lipid film. The damage is surface-mediated but cumulative.
